Clinical characteristics and outcomes of patients with takotsubo syndrome versus spontaneous coronary artery dissection
BACKGROUND: Takotsubo syndrome (TTS) and spontaneous coronary artery dissection (SCAD) are now increasingly recognized. Both conditions predominantly affect females; however, the exact pathophysiology remains unclear. Large multi-center databases can help elucidate the underlying mechanism and optim...
